Package de.jungblut.classification.nn
-
Class Summary Class Description MLPWeightMapper MultilayerPerceptron Multilayer perceptron implementation that works on GPU via JCuda and CPU.MultilayerPerceptron.MultilayerPerceptronBuilder Configuration for training a neural net through theClassifierMultilayerPerceptronCostFunction Neural network costfunction for a multilayer perceptron.MultilayerPerceptronCostFunction.NetworkConfiguration RBM Class for training and stacking Restricted Boltzmann Machines (RBMs).RBM.RBMBuilder RBMCostFunction Restricted Boltzmann machine implementation using Contrastive Divergence 1 (CD1).WeightMatrix Weight matrix wrapper to encapsulate the random initialization. -
Enum Summary Enum Description TrainingType Train normally on the CPU or on the GPU via CUDA?